Anterior suprapatellar fat pad impingement syndrome

Discussion:

The anterior suprapatellar fat pad is an intracapsular, but extrasynovial structure, located just posterior to the quadriceps tendon, anterior to the prepatellar joint recess, and superior to the patellar base and retropatellar cartilage, usually triangular in shape. 

Anterior suprapatellar fat pad signal abnormalities and mass effect (indicating edema), with no other significant findings, and the clinical presentation in this case, are compatible with anterior suprapatellar fat pad impingement syndrome.
